7-Way to Cigarette Lighter Adapter for Powering Air Compressor

Question:
Thx Jameson. Looks good. I have that connector, albeit a single outlet vs a double. My p450 Viair compressor has alligator clips to connect to 12v, not a cigarette lighter connector. So, I purchased the Wilson. (See pic). Its the 10A fuse in the Wilson that keeps blowing. Need a connector with more amperage.

Expert Reply:
Sounds like your air compressor is drawing more amperage than your adapter is rated for. A better adapter solution would be the part # 118019 which doesn't have the 10 amp restriction like your current adapter.
